Commercial Slab Installation Questions
What types of projects require a concrete slab? Concrete slabs are commonly used for driveways, patios, garage floors, and commercial building foundations.
How thick should a concrete slab be? The thickness depends on the intended use, typically ranging from 4 to 6 inches for residential applications.
What preparation is needed before slab installation? Proper site grading, soil compaction, and a stable base are essential for a durable slab.
Can a concrete slab be customized in size and shape? Yes, slabs can be poured in various sizes and shapes to suit specific property requirements.
